The crossed extension reflex is a withdrawal reflex. The
main idea here is that when the flexor muscles on one side of the body are
contracted, there is the occurrence of a reflex contraction of the extensors on
the other side.

Living organisms that are heterotrophic include all animals and fungi, some bacteria and protists, and many parasitic plants. The term heterotroph arose in microbiology in 1946 as part of a classification of microorganisms based on their type of nutrition.
